It was announced by the Department of Information and Communications Technology that the registration deadline for SIM cards would not be extended past April 26.

The DICT spokesperson, Undersecretary Anna Mae Lamentillo, advised the general public to take the deadline seriously.

“As the deadline for SIM registration draws near, it is imperative that all unregistered citizens take this matter seriously and register their SIMs without delay,” Lamentillo said.

“Take the necessary steps to register your SIMs today and avoid the inconvenience and deactivation that comes with non-compliance.”

All current SIM subscribers must register by submitting a completed form through a database platform or website made available by their telecommunications provider.

The SIM Registration Act (Republic Act No. 11934), the first law signed by President Ferdinand Marcos Jr. in October, aims to control the registration and use of SIMs by requiring all end users to register their SIMs with their telecommunications networks before they are activated.
